首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Pandas读取具有多个行、列和合并单元格表头的excel表格

Pandas是一个强大的数据处理和分析工具,可以用于读取和处理具有多个行、列和合并单元格表头的Excel表格。下面是一个完善且全面的答案:

Pandas是Python中一个开源的数据分析库,提供了丰富的数据结构和数据分析工具,可以轻松处理和分析各种数据。它的主要数据结构是DataFrame,它类似于Excel中的表格,可以存储和处理二维数据。

要读取具有多个行、列和合并单元格表头的Excel表格,可以使用Pandas的read_excel函数。该函数可以读取Excel文件,并将其转换为DataFrame对象,方便后续的数据处理和分析。

在读取Excel表格时,可以通过指定参数来处理多个行、列和合并单元格表头。例如,可以使用header参数来指定表头所在的行数,使用skiprows参数来跳过不需要的行,使用usecols参数来选择需要的列。

对于合并单元格的表头,可以使用Pandas的MultiIndex功能来处理。MultiIndex可以创建多级索引,用于表示多个行、列的层次结构。可以使用header参数来指定表头所在的行数,并使用skiprows参数来跳过不需要的行。然后,可以使用Pandas的concat函数将多个行、列的层次结构合并为一个MultiIndex对象。

Pandas提供了丰富的数据处理和分析功能,可以对读取的Excel表格进行各种操作。例如,可以使用Pandas的查询、过滤、排序、分组、聚合等功能来对数据进行处理和分析。此外,Pandas还提供了可视化功能,可以将数据可视化为图表,方便数据分析和展示。

对于读取具有多个行、列和合并单元格表头的Excel表格,腾讯云提供了云对象存储(COS)服务,可以将Excel文件上传到COS中,并使用Pandas的read_excel函数从COS中读取Excel文件。腾讯云的COS服务提供了高可靠性、高可用性和高扩展性,可以满足各种数据存储和处理需求。

腾讯云对象存储(COS)产品介绍链接地址:https://cloud.tencent.com/product/cos

总结:Pandas是一个强大的数据处理和分析工具,可以用于读取和处理具有多个行、列和合并单元格表头的Excel表格。腾讯云提供了云对象存储(COS)服务,可以将Excel文件上传到COS中,并使用Pandas的read_excel函数从COS中读取Excel文件。这样可以实现高效、可靠的Excel数据处理和分析。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

.NET Core使用NPOI导出复杂,美观的Excel详解

这段时间一直专注于数据报表的开发,当然涉及到相关报表的开发数据导出肯定是一个不可避免的问题啦。客户要求要导出优雅,美观的Excel文档格式的来展示数据,当时的第一想法就是使用NPOI开源库来做数据导出Excel文档(当时想想真香,网上随便搜一搜教程一大堆),但是当自己真正的实践起来才知道原来想要给不同的单元格设置相关的字体样式、边框样式以及单元格样式一个简单的样式需要写这么多行代码来实现。作为一个喜欢编写简洁代码的我而言肯定是受不了的,于是乎提起袖子说干就干,我自己根据网上的一些资料自己封装了一个通用的NPOI导出Excel帮助类,主要包括行列创建,行内单元格常用样式封装(如:字体样式,字体颜色,字体大小,单元格背景颜色,单元格边框,单元格内容对齐方式等常用属性),希望在以后的开发中能够使用到,并且也希望能够帮助到更多有需要的同学。

01
领券